The Strategic Advantage of White Label Travel Portals
At its core, a white label travel portal is designed to simplify market entry. Instead of building booking engines, negotiating API contracts, and maintaining servers, travel businesses can leverage a ready-made solution. The provider manages the technical infrastructure, while the agency focuses on branding, marketing, pricing strategies, and customer relationships.
This separation of responsibilities allows businesses to operate efficiently and scale faster. From the customer’s perspective, the platform appears as a proprietary travel website, reinforcing brand trust and loyalty. For agencies, it offers the ability to compete with large online travel agencies without matching their development budgets.
Comprehensive Booking Capabilities
A key benefit of a white label travel portal is its ability to bring multiple travel services together in one system. Flight booking modules typically integrate with multiple airline sources and GDS networks, offering real-time seat availability and competitive fares across domestic and international routes. Customers can search, compare, and book flights seamlessly, improving overall user experience.

Centralized Administration and Business Control
Operational efficiency is critical for profitability in the travel industry. White label travel portals address this need through a centralized admin dashboard that provides full visibility and control over business operations. Administrators can manage markups, commissions, bookings, cancellations, and refunds from a single interface.
Advanced reporting and analytics tools help agencies monitor sales performance, identify popular routes or destinations, and track revenue trends. These insights support data-driven decision-making and allow businesses to adjust pricing, promotions, and inventory focus based on real demand patterns.
